Russia captured the Zaporizhzhia nuclear plant in early March shortly after invading Ukraine, however Ukrainian workers had continued to function it. Each Moscow and Kyiv have since accused one another of shelling the power, risking a nuclear catastrophe.
“The Zaporizhzhia nuclear plant is now on the territory of the Russian Federation and, accordingly, ought to be operated beneath the supervision of our related companies,” RIA quoted deputy overseas minister Sergei Vershinin as saying.
It was not clear how Russia deliberate to function the plant and if it will try to introduce its personal workers to the advanced.
One other state-owned Russian information company, TASS, reported that Rafael Grossi, head of the Worldwide Atomic Power Company (IAEA), the UN nuclear watchdog, will go to Moscow within the coming days to debate the state of affairs on the plant.
Russia acted to annex Zaporizhzhia and three different areas after holding what it referred to as referendums – votes that had been denounced by Kyiv and Western governments as unlawful and coercive. Moscow doesn’t absolutely management any of the areas.
